Prototypes come in various formats, each designed to serve specific objectives in the product development process. Below are some common types and their purposes:
Paper Prototypes: These are basic, hand-drawn sketches or mock-ups used early in the process to brainstorm and explore initial ideas and concepts.
Low-Fidelity Prototypes: Simple, rough models that represent the structure or layout of a product. These are useful for quick concept validation and gathering initial user feedback.
High-Fidelity Prototypes: More detailed and polished models that closely mimic the final product, allowing for thorough testing of design, functionality, and user experience.
Clickable Prototypes: These interactive models simulate navigation and user flow, providing insights into usability and helping optimise the user journey.
Functional Prototypes: Focus on demonstrating specific features or functions of a product, allowing developers to test core functionalities in real-world conditions.
Interactive Prototypes: In-depth, user-interactive models that simulate realistic interactions and gather comprehensive feedback on usability, layout, and overall experience.
Horizontal Prototypes: Designed to showcase a wide range of functionalities, but without depth in any single area. They’re useful for testing the overall concept and functionality at a high level.
Vertical Prototypes: Focus on a specific feature or functionality in detail, helping to assess the technical and design feasibility of particular aspects.
Exploratory Prototypes: Developed during the early stages of brainstorming or research, these prototypes help test and explore different ideas and approaches to find the best solution.
Feasibility Prototypes: Built to test the viability of specific features or technical concepts, they help verify whether an idea is practical before full-scale development.
Visual Prototypes: Primarily concerned with the aesthetic aspects of a product, these prototypes help stakeholders assess the visual appeal and overall design.
Proof-of-Concept (POC): Demonstrates the core functionality of an idea, often used to validate a concept and gain support for further development.
Each prototype type is vital in the iterative process of product development, ensuring that ideas are refined, functionality is validated, user experiences are tested, and the final product aligns with both user needs and business objectives.
What is the time frame for Developing an AI Prototype?
The development timeline for an AI prototype can vary significantly based on the project’s complexity and scope. Simple prototypes, focusing on specific features or concepts, may be completed in just a few weeks. However, more intricate prototypes that involve complex data processing, extensive model training, and detailed fine-tuning can take several months to develop. Key factors influencing the timeline include the project’s size, the level of customisation required, the technology stack used, and the time needed for testing and iterations. As every AI prototype is unique, a thorough understanding of the project’s requirements will provide a more precise estimate of the development timeframe.
Creating an AI product prototype requires leveraging various advanced tools and frameworks designed to streamline development, testing, and refinement. Key tools for building and enhancing AI prototypes include:
Relume: A platform specialising in AI-driven website creation, enabling quick development of user-centric prototypes.
TensorFlow: Google’s open-source machine learning framework, commonly used for building and deploying AI models across a variety of applications.
Keras: A high-level neural network API built on TensorFlow, ideal for quick prototyping and development of deep learning models.
PyTorch: Known for its flexibility and ease of use, PyTorch is a preferred deep learning framework for research and AI model development.
OpenAI’s GPT-3: A state-of-the-art language model useful for integrating natural language processing features into AI prototypes, such as conversational AI and automated content creation.
These tools, among others, are essential for transforming AI concepts into operational prototypes, enabling thorough testing and iterative improvements throughout the development process.
